- The little girl, seeing she had lost one of her pretty shoes, grew angry, and said to the Witch, "Give me back my shoe!"
- "I will not," retorted the Witch, "for it is now my shoe, and not yours."
- "You are a wicked creature!" cried Dorothy. "You have no right to take my shoe from me."
- "I shall keep it, just the same," said the Witch, laughing at her, "and someday I shall get the other one from you, too."
- This made Dorothy so very angry that she picked up the bucket of water that stood near and dashed it over the Witch, wetting her from head to foot.
- Instantly the wicked woman gave a loud cry of fear, and then, as Dorothy looked at her in wonder, the Witch began to shrink and fall away.
- "See what you have done!" she screamed. "In a minute I shall melt away."
- "I’m very sorry, indeed," said Dorothy, who was truly frightened to see the Witch actually melting away like brown sugar before her very eyes.
- "Didn’t you know water would be the end of me?" asked the Witch, in a wailing, despairing voice.
- "Of course not," answered Dorothy. "How should I?"
